By joining our Independence Section as a Administrative Specialist Senior in Kenton County, you’ll have the opportunity to provide high-level professional administrative support to internal staff and leadership related to an agency’s business operations. This position performs duties in the oversight of intricate processes, such as activities involving mandated regulations or procedures, comprehensive research, or collaboration with internal and external stakeholders.

Requirements

  • Graduate of a college or university with a bachelor's degree.
  • Three years of professional, administrative, or business experience.
  • Additional education will substitute for the required experience on a year-for-year basis.
  • Additional administrative, business, research, and/or clerical experience will substitute for the required education on a year-for-year basis.

Responsibilities

  • Perform research investigations and issuance of driver licenses, permits, and identification cards maintaining complex driving history records.
  • Compile daily reports and train new employees.
  • Review and process non-United States citizens applications.
  • Perform customer services for all agencies, state and federal.
